Iran’s top diplomat visits Saudi Arabia, using his first trip there since the two Middle East rivals announced a surprise rapprochement in March to slam Israel.
Hossein Amir-Abdollahian takes the opportunity to reiterate the Islamic Republic’s support for the Palestinian cause at a time when Riyadh is in discussions with the United States about potentially normalizing ties with Israel.
Standing next to Saudi Arabia’s Prince Faisal, Amir-Abdollahian describes the conflict as “the most important issue in the Islamic world,” adding: “We continue to support Palestine.”
“There is no doubt that the Zionist regime will continue its efforts to create division in the Muslim world and the region. We follow the movements of the Zionist regime with insight and vigilance,” he adds.
